As a HSE specialist, you will be responsible for:
Supporting Regional HSE leaderDeveloping and implementing HSE programs at Customer site.Supporting BH site manager and site team to ensure compliance with any HSE laws and regulations applicable at Customer site.Investigating and completing RCA in case of injury/accident/Near Miss at Customer site with a final report to be provided to HSE team and BH site manager;Supporting activities in case of external HSE audits on site;all HSE documents recordkeeping on site which shall be available for any audits/inspections internal and external;Providing guidance to BH team in obtaining Permit to Work and LOTO appliance;Providing site induction to BH and BH contractors employees for the site;Providing periodical Tool-box Talk and HSE Standdowns to BH team and participate to HSE meetings organized by customer;Providing daily/weekly report as required by BH HSE team, including site HSE statistics and compliance status;Ensuring Concern Reports are uploaded at site and provide weekly reports in Batch upload format to HSE Team;Providing a final report of the activities carried out and lesson learned.Looking for area for improvements and strengthening HSE culture among the teams

To be successful in this role you will:
Have more than 7 years’ experience on HSE site operational environmentDegree/Diploma qualified in science or engineering discipline (or equivalent)Have industry and hands-on knowledge of oil and gas industryHave solid knowledge of local HSE regulations in Kazakhstan and CISHave fluent Kazakh/Russian and upper-intermediate level of EnglishHave locally or internationally recognized professional HSE qualification up to date with training requirements is preferable Be located in AstanaBe able to show good problem-solving, process improvement and analytical skillsHave excellent communication skills and the ability to work successfully with a wide variety of people at different levels within the organizationPossess excellent oral and written communication skills
